Enhancement: LH to introduce CC surcharge

LH will introduce an "optional payment charge" for payment by credit card from 02.Nov 2011.

EUR 5 per ticket for domestic tickets
EUR 8 per ticket for European tickets
EUR 18 per ticket for longhaul

For tickets originating in D, CH, B, SF, UK and NL.

Until now the service fee included €5 for payment by CC.
This means in case of payment by CC the service fees will stay at €15 for intra-German and raise to from €15 to €18 for European and from €20 to €33 for Intercontinental flights.
